## Configuration (Quenby Queue Migration)

We're replacing the homegrown job queue (src/legacy/spooler) with Quenby. Workers read all settings from the env file; no YAML remains. Set QUENBY_BROKER_HOST to the regional broker, QUENBY_CONCURRENCY to match your worker count, and QUENBY_RETRY_CAP to 5 for parity with the old spooler defaults. Dead-letter routing is on by default. The broker rejects unauthenticated workers, so the env file must also carry the following line.

sealed setting: RELAY_SECRET5=82864

Nice writeup on the Glimmerfeed stale-cache postmortem. One nit: the fix in `CacheWarden` only bumps the version on writes, not deletes, so tombstones can still serve stale reads for a few seconds. Worth a follow-up ticket? Otherwise the new TTL logic looks sane. For reviewers, here are the constants we settled on after the incident:

tuning table, faweg-bajep:
WEIGHTS = {
    "belius": 690,
    "eliox": 458,
    "norax": 616,
    "praion": 132,
    "zorvan": 911,
}

Postmortem timeline — export retry incident (Fernwald Analytics). 14:02: nightly export job to the Larkspur archive failed on 3,100 records. 14:20: Priya confirmed the retry queue was stalled, not draining. 14:45: manual requeue triggered; 80% succeeded. 15:30: remaining failures traced to a malformed batch header from Tuesday's schema change. 16:10: header fix deployed, full retry completed cleanly. Retries are now capped at five with exponential backoff. The fix shipped in the following build.

pipeline stamp: htk9_6ce9d33c5